A sophomore guard from Columbia, South Carolina, Dunlap averaged 24.5 points, 4.0 rebounds, 2.0 assists and 2.0 steals per game in Southern Wesleyan’s first two games of the 2021-22 regular season. Dunlap also shot an incredibly impressive 65 percent (17-of-26) from the field. He also shot 85 percent (11-of-13) from the charity stripe and 40 percent (4-of-10) from beyond the arc. In Southern Wesleyan’s season-opening win over Lander on Nov. 12, Dunlap ended his efforts with 26 points, four assists, three rebounds and two steals. Dunlap followed that up by finishing with 23 points, five rebounds and two steals against second-ranked Flagler on Nov. 13.
